1. A policyholder reports hail damage to a residential roof two weeks after a storm. What is
the adjuster’s PRIMARY responsibility during the initial claim investigation?

A. Approve payment immediately to avoid bad faith exposure
B. Determine whether the policy provides coverage for the reported loss
C. Recommend a roofing contractor to the insured
D. Negotiate depreciation before inspecting the property

════════════════════

Correct Answer: B. Determine whether the policy provides coverage for the reported loss

Rationale:

The adjuster’s first responsibility is to verify whether coverage applies under the policy terms,
conditions, exclusions, and endorsements. An adjuster must investigate facts before
authorizing payment. Recommending contractors may create ethical concerns, and
negotiating depreciation before inspection is premature.

════════════════════

2. An adjuster discovers that an insured intentionally exaggerated the value of stolen property
during a theft claim. What should the adjuster do FIRST?

A. Immediately deny the entire claim
B. Refer the matter for possible fraud investigation
C. Pay the undisputed portion and ignore the discrepancy
D. Notify the police directly without documentation

════════════════════

Correct Answer: B. Refer the matter for possible fraud investigation

Rationale:

Suspected fraud should be documented and referred according to company procedures and
state regulations. Immediate denial without investigation may violate claims-handling
standards. Law enforcement involvement typically follows internal fraud review procedures.

,════════════════════

3. Which principle prevents an insured from collecting more than the actual amount of a
covered loss?

A. Waiver
B. Adhesion
C. Indemnity
D. Estoppel

════════════════════

Correct Answer: C. Indemnity

Rationale:

The principle of indemnity restores the insured to approximately the same financial position
occupied before the loss without allowing profit from insurance. Waiver and estoppel involve
legal rights, while adhesion relates to contract interpretation.

════════════════════

4. A claimant slips on spilled liquid inside a grocery store. Which type of insurance policy
would MOST likely respond to the claim?

A. Commercial property insurance
B. Workers’ compensation insurance
C. Inland marine insurance
D. Commercial general liability insurance

════════════════════

Correct Answer: D. Commercial general liability insurance

Rationale:

Commercial general liability coverage commonly applies to bodily injury claims arising from
premises operations. Property insurance covers physical property damage, while workers’
compensation applies to employee injuries.

════════════════════

5. An adjuster handling an automobile collision claim notices conflicting witness statements.
What is the BEST course of action?

A. Accept the insured’s version automatically
B. Deny the claim due to inconsistent testimony

,C. Conduct additional investigation before determining liability
D. Split liability equally between both drivers immediately

════════════════════

Correct Answer: C. Conduct additional investigation before determining liability

Rationale:

Conflicting statements require further investigation such as scene analysis, recorded
statements, photographs, police reports, or expert review. Liability should not be assumed
without adequate supporting evidence.

════════════════════

6. What is the purpose of a deductible in an insurance policy?

A. To eliminate underwriting requirements
B. To reduce small claims frequency and share risk with the insured
C. To increase insurer liability exposure
D. To guarantee replacement cost settlement

════════════════════

Correct Answer: B. To reduce small claims frequency and share risk with the insured

Rationale:

Deductibles encourage insureds to absorb minor losses and help insurers reduce
administrative costs associated with small claims. They also promote responsible risk
management by policyholders.

════════════════════

7. An adjuster receives a claim for flood damage under a standard homeowners policy. How
should the adjuster respond?

A. Confirm whether separate flood coverage exists because flood is generally excluded
B. Automatically approve coverage due to water intrusion
C. Apply earthquake coverage provisions
D. Settle the claim under personal liability coverage

════════════════════

Correct Answer: A. Confirm whether separate flood coverage exists because flood is generally
excluded

, Rationale:

Standard homeowners policies generally exclude flood damage. Coverage may exist through
a separate flood insurance policy. The adjuster must verify policy terms before determining
coverage.

════════════════════

8. Which document outlines the specific protections, exclusions, and duties under an
insurance contract?

A. Declaration page only
B. Loss reserve worksheet
C. Insurance policy
D. Proof of loss form

════════════════════

Correct Answer: C. Insurance policy

Rationale:

The insurance policy contains the insuring agreement, conditions, exclusions, endorsements,
and obligations of both parties. The declarations page summarizes key information but does
not contain all contractual provisions.

════════════════════

9. A claims adjuster intentionally delays communication with an insured to pressure
acceptance of a lower settlement. This practice may constitute:

A. Arbitration
B. Comparative negligence
C. Fair underwriting
D. Bad faith claims handling

════════════════════

Correct Answer: D. Bad faith claims handling

Rationale:

Unreasonable delays or coercive settlement tactics may violate fair claims practices and
expose the insurer to bad faith liability. Adjusters are expected to act promptly and fairly.

════════════════════
